General description
Ferroconcrete bridges, metal and timber bridges, prestressed bridges. Methods of prestressing and fittings anchoring. Arch and rigid frame bridges. suspension and cable stayed bridges. Pedestrian bridges. Constructions of beams. Static schemes, materials used. Pillars. Connecting to the embankment, construction of deformation joints and retaining elements. Specifics of the calculations related to different types of bridges. Bridge construction strengthening. Construction organising and technology.
General aim
The aim of the course is to give students knowledge concerning different types of bridges (viaducts) - beam bridges, girder bridges, arch and rigid frame bridges, suspension and cable stayed bridges. The course aslo includes the spesifics of different calculations.
Aim
After mastering the course the students will know the basic calculation methods related to different types of bridges and be able to carry out practical tasks realated to mentioned facilities.
Form description
During lectures the theoretical basis of designing is gained and sample tasks are made. Composing synopis. Examination in written form.
